Lancaster, PA – Person Injured in Pedestrian Crash at E Frederick St & N Queen St

Calendar today
November 15, 2025

Lancaster, PA (November 15, 2025) – A pedestrian was hurt on November 14 after a vehicle struck them at a Lancaster intersection.

The crash happened around 5:34 p.m. at East Frederick Street and North Queen Street, according to emergency radio traffic. Multiple emergency units responded to reports of a person down in the roadway after being hit. The intersection sits in a dense part of Lancaster City, where many people walk during the evening hours.

First responders reached the scene quickly and began treating the victim. Paramedics stabilized the pedestrian and then took them to a local hospital. Officials have not released the person’s age or current condition.

Lancaster police also arrived and began speaking with witnesses. They reviewed the area for cameras and checked for any evidence that could explain how the crash unfolded.

More details are expected as officers continue to gather statements and analyze the scene. Lancaster Police say the investigation is ongoing.

Pedestrian Accidents in Lancaster

Pedestrian accidents remain a significant concern in Lancaster. The city has many narrow streets, busy intersections, and steady foot traffic throughout the day. Areas near N Queen Street are especially active, which increases the chance of a crash when drivers fail to look for pedestrians. Even one moment of inattention can lead to severe injuries because pedestrians have no protection from the force of a moving vehicle.

Pennsylvania has seen a rise in pedestrian crashes over the past several years. Many of these incidents happen in urban areas, where drivers and walkers move through the same crowded spaces. When a crash occurs, the pedestrian often takes the full impact. Common injuries include broken bones, spinal injuries, and head trauma. Some victims need surgery, long-term therapy, or months of recovery. These injuries can also make it hard for victims to return to work or care for their families.

Medical bills pile up quickly after a pedestrian crash. Victims may face emergency room expenses, ongoing care, medication, transportation needs, and lost wages. On top of that, emotional distress adds another challenge.

When a driver causes harm through careless or reckless behavior, the pedestrian has legal rights. Pennsylvania law allows injured victims to pursue compensation for medical costs, lost income, pain and suffering, and other losses. However, insurance companies often work to limit their payouts. They may blame the pedestrian or argue that the injuries are not as serious as reported. This can make the claims process overwhelming, especially for someone trying to recover.
